Release Information

The MMWAVE MCUPLUS SDK enables the development of 2nd generation millimeter wave (mmWave) radar applications using TI mmWave sensors (see list of supported Platform / Devices).The SDK provides foundational components which will facilitate end users to focus on their applications.

What's new

  • AWR2x44P: Platform Support for DPL, Drivers, and SBL
  • AWR2x44P: Out of Box (OOB) demo supporting TDM, DDM processing and ethernet streaming with power optimization hooks
  • AWR2x44P / AWR2944LC / AWR294x (Memory optimization): Re-use radar cube memory to store the detected objects list.
  • AWR2x44P / AWR2944LC / AWR294x (Timing optimization): Use EDMA to copy antenna samples of detected objects in Doppler DPU
  • AWR2x44P / AWR2944LC / AWR294x: Histogram based detection on Doppler - azimuth heatmap (Compile time option)
  • AWR294x: DDMA demodulation and max sub-band computation on HWA with band-wise transpose using EDMA
  • AWR2544: gPTP stack integration with OOB (Trigger frames through CPTS timestamp)
  • AWR2x44P/ AWR294x/ AWR2544: Enabled GENF signal configuration through TSN stack
  • AWR2x44P/ AWR294x: C66 Context save/restore feature with example
